FREE Quickpay account for any US webmaster
 
Quickpay is a bank to bank transfer with no fees. Quickpay allows any US based bank to transfer or recieve money from Chase bank. If your bank is not Chase you don't need a Chase account to use this service. In order to signup and begin using this service post your email addy and prefered nickname here. We will sign you up and Chase will send you a email. Follow the directions in the email from Chase. After you verify the signup you can send or recieve money to any Chase bank account for free.

Chase has no limits on Quickpay. There are no limits unless it's on the receiving bank end, I've never encountered that situation though. Savings accounts have Fed sending restrictions using ACH but no Fed receiving restrictions.
